Summary
If you make $249,177,240 a year living in the region of Quebec, Canada, you will be taxed $132,799,136. That means that your net pay will be $116,378,104 per year, or $9,698,175 per month. Your average tax rate is 53.3% and your marginal tax rate is 53.3%. This marginal tax rate means that your immediate additional income will be taxed at this rate. For instance, an increase of $100 in your salary will be taxed $53.31, hence, your net pay will only increase by $46.69.
